Most of the ftp accounts I work with have archive folders, where the expected practice is to move any files that are downloaded to the archive folder on the ftp after the file has been downloaded.

Is there any way to do this with Automate 10? I've looked through the help file and not found a command that does this. Currently, the only method I've found to do this is to download the file from the ftp, delete the file from the original ftp folder, and upload the file back to the ftp archive folder. it would be very helpful to have a move command to allow files to be moved between ftp folders.

Hello Dan,

Unfortunately the method you described is currently our only option. There is a feature request to implement this type of action into the software, but currently download and reupload is the only option.

The FTP rename command is how you move a file (on a Linux or Unix server I guess?)
